把TP中心化转换USDT的流程拆开看,你会发现它不是“点一下换币”那么简单,而是一套围绕实时汇率、实时数据监控、多链支付技术管理与高效支付技术的工程体系。下面按步骤带你把关键模块搭起来,顺便给出可落地的技术思路。
第一步:实时汇率(Real-time FX)怎么做得“够快、够准”
- 价格源:优先聚合多个行情源,做中位数/加权平均,降低单点波动。
- 采样与刷新:设置ms级刷新间隔(例如500ms-2s),并为每个源记录延迟与失真率。
- 价格可信度:引入“偏离阈值”与“滑动窗口”验证,例如当前价若偏离过去N分钟中位数超过阈值,触发降权或熔断。
- 结算价策略:下单到执行之间通常有延迟,建议锁价窗口(quote TTL),并明确超时重引擎。
第二步:实时数据监控(Observability)把异常提前抓住
- 核心指标:
- 引擎延迟(quote_latency / execution_latency)
- 失败率(swap_failed_ratio)与错误码分布
- 流控状态(queue_depth、rate_limit)
- 链上确认时间(confirm_time)
- 数据链路:从“报价服务→风控→路由→执行器→回执服务”全链路追踪。
- 触发机制:
- 阈值告警(例如失败率突增)
- 统计告警(EWMA/3σ)
- 黑名单告警(行情源异常、地址异常)
- 报表落地:按分钟/小时/天生成汇总,供“运营与风控”联动决策。
第三步:多链支付技术管理(Multi-chain Payment Ops)让系统可扩展
- 统一抽象层:把不同链的转账、手续费、确认策略抽象成同一接口(例如 PaymentRoute.submit)。
- 路由与重试:为每条链维护“可用性评分”,失败后走备用路由;幂等提交,避免重复支付。
- 地址与凭证管理:
- 钱包/地址池管理(热钱包、冷钱包策略)
- API Key/签名密钥轮换(key rotation)
- 资金隔离(按业务域/风险域拆分)

- 手续费与拥堵:链上拥堵时自动调整 Gas 策略或切换到更优路由。
第四步:高效支付技术(High-throughput Execution)让吞吐“上去”
- 批处理与管道化:对报价、路由选择、签名生成进行异步流水线。
- 缓存:将“常用汇率/路由配置/手续费估算”做短时缓存(秒级),减少外部调用。

- 并发控制:限流 + 令牌桶,按用户等级/风险等级分层。
- 幂等与一致性:用请求ID/nonce确保重复请求不会重复扣款;对回执采用状态机(pending→executed→settled/failed)。
第五步:创新支付解决方案(Creative Fintech Patterns)
- 分层报价:把“实时汇率用于展示 + 执行价用于结算”的规则写死在引擎,减少争议。
- 智能路https://www.shsnsyc.com ,由:结合链上费用、确认时间、失败率,做多目标优化(成本、速度、成功率)。
- 风控联动:
- 地址风险(黑名单/异常簇)
- 交易行为(频率、滑点、对手方模式)
- 价格风险(滑点超限直接拒绝或改用保守报价)
第六步:数据报告(Reporting)让“跑得动”变成“看得懂”
- 报告结构:
- 业务概览:成交量、成功率、平均耗时
- 风险概览:失败原因Top、滑点分布、行情偏离次数
- 供应链概览:行情源健康度、链路可用性评分
- 复盘机制:每周回顾“失败/延迟”与“行情异常”的关联,迭代阈值与路由。
金融科技发展视角:从中心化转换到更智能的“可控中心化”
TP中心化转换USDT的价值,不只在速度,更在可控:实时汇率与监控让你“知道发生了什么”,多链支付与高效执行让你“能持续发生”。把工程化、风控化、数据化做扎实,才能在高速变化的链上环境里保持稳定交付。
FQA
1) Q:实时汇率用单一行情源可以吗?
A:不建议。多源聚合并做可信度评估可显著降低异常行情导致的滑点与错误执行。
2) Q:多链支付是否需要完全不同的代码?
A:建议做统一抽象层,把链特性封装到路由与执行器,业务层只调用同一接口。
3) Q:如何避免重复扣款与重复入账?
A:使用幂等机制(请求ID/nonce)+ 状态机回执校验,确保重复提交不会重复结算。
互动投票(选3-5项并回复你的选择)
1)你更关心:实时汇率精度还是执行速度?
2)你希望优先支持哪几条链:EVM为主、还是混合多链?
3)遇到异常时你倾向:自动熔断保守报价,还是继续尝试备用路由?
4)你更想看哪类数据报告:成本/速度/失败原因?
5)你希望文章下一篇聚焦:风控阈值设计还是幂等与状态机实现?